Prime Gap of 1

Suppose a a and b b are positive integers such that a > 2 a > 2 and b = a + 1 b = a + 1 .

Can a a and b b both be primes ?

If a is prime it has to be odd since a>2. So a+1 will be even and so their are not both prime
